Transaction 859a330a1719136fa1d30000cbb3a5bf7a2d37edf9271675dbd456ec540325f9
1 Input
1 Output
-
859a330a1719136fa1d30000cbb3a5bf7a2d37edf9271675dbd456ec540325f9:0
- value
- 538500000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c86714c1f22ed365a01966a3ccb6f42bd4dbd86d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KGddZny6Bq6KGnfpi8bhLVmmMnnsY8QSD